Wildlands Festival 2026 was the perfect way to kick off the new year. With the sun out, the weather warm, and the crowd in full festival mode, the atmosphere felt electric from the moment gates opened.

The lineup offered a diverse mix of artists, each bringing their own sound and style to the stage and shaping the day into something uniquely Wild. Early sets created a steady build of momentum as fans danced their way into 2026 with standout performances coming from Jazzy, Channel Tres, Waxx Off, 070 Shake, Chris Stussy, and Kettama. Each artist lifted the energy higher, turning the festival grounds into a pulsing celebration of sound and rhythm.

But the defining moment of the day came with Kid Cudi’s long-awaited return to Australia. After years away, seeing him back on stage felt genuinely special. With a career now spanning close to two decades, Cudi’s influence on modern music is undeniable. Kid Cudi performed a range of hits including Day ’n’ Nite, Ghost!, Mr. Rager, Pursuit of Happiness, and Memories, transporting the crowd back through time and tapping into a shared nostalgia that felt both deeply personal and collective.

By the time the sun began to fade and the final sets rolled through, the festival had already done its job. Wildlands 2026 delivered not just a lineup, but a feeling. A sense of joy, release, and happiness that made it the perfect way to begin the year.
